59985 is a odd composite number that follows 59984 and precedes 59986. It is composed of 24 distinct factors: 1, 3, 5, 9, 15, 31, 43, 45, 93, 129, 155, 215, 279, 387, 465, 645, 1333, 1395, 1935, 3999, 6665, 11997, 19995, 59985. Its prime factorization can be written as 3^2 × 5 × 31 × 43. 59985 is classified as a deficient number based on the sum of its proper divisors. In computer science, 59985 is represented as 1110101001010001 in binary and EA51 in hexadecimal.
